Silicone Alkyd Top Coat Market Outlook
The global silicone alkyd top coat market is anticipated to reach USD 1.2 billion by 2035, registering a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 6.4%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th can be attributed to the increasing demand for durable and high-performance coatings in various industries such as construction, automotive, and marine applications. Additionally, the rigorous standards for environmental sustainability and the demand for low-VOC (Volatile Organic Compounds) products are propelling the growth of the silicone alkyd top coat market. The expanding construction sector, along with rising investments in infrastructure development, particularly in emerging economies, further contributes to the market's expansion. Furthermore, the versatility and superior properties of silicone alkyd coatings, such as excellent weather resistance and adhesion properties, are attracting a wider range of applications.

By Product Type
Waterborne Silicone Alkyd Top Coat:
The waterborne silicone alkyd top coat segment has gained significant traction due to its eco-friendly nature and low VOC emissions. This type of coating is preferred in both residential and commercial applications, particularly in areas where stringent environmental regulations are in place. The ease of application and cleaning with water makes it a popular choice among contractors and DIY enthusiasts. Moreover, waterborne silicone alkyd coatings provide excellent adhesion and durability, making them suitable for a wide range of substrates, including wood, metal, and masonry. As consumers become more environmentally conscious, the demand for waterborne products is expected to rise steadily in the coming years.
Solvent-Borne Silicone Alkyd Top Coat:
Solvent-borne silicone alkyd top coats remain a staple in the market, known for their exceptional durability and resistance to harsh environmental conditions. These coatings are widely used in industrial applications, with a strong presence in the automotive and marine industries, where superior performance and longevity are crucial. Solvent-borne formulations offer excellent leveling properties, making them ideal for achieving smooth and aesthetically pleasing finishes. However, the increasing regulatory pressures surrounding solvent emissions may pose challenges to this segment, leading manufacturers to innovate towards more sustainable alternatives.
High Solid Silicone Alkyd Top Coat:
The high solid silicone alkyd top coat segment is characterized by its reduced solvent content, resulting in lower VOC emissions and higher film thickness per coat. This product type is often favored in applications requiring heavy-duty protection, such as industrial machinery and infrastructure. The ability to achieve excellent durability with fewer coats appeals to manufacturers looking to optimize costs and improve productivity. As regulations tighten and industries seek sustainable solutions, high solid silicone alkyd coatings are expected to witness increased adoption, driving growth in this segment.
Powder Silicone Alkyd Top Coat:
Powder silicone alkyd top coats represent a niche but growing segment of the market, favored for their environmental benefits and application efficiency. These coatings are applied through electrostatic spraying or fluidized bed processes, ensuring minimal wastage and a high-quality finish. The powder form eliminates the need for solvents, aligning with sustainability goals in various industries. Their excellent resistance to chemicals, heat, and impact makes them suitable for applications in automotive and industrial settings. Continued advancements in powder coating technology are expected to broaden the application scope and enhance market penetration.

By Region
The regional analysis of the silicone alkyd top coat market reveals distinct patterns of demand and growth across different areas. North America is currently leading the market, accounting for approximately 30% of the global share, driven by robust construction activities and a strong automotive sector. The region's emphasis on advanced coatings solutions and environmental regulations mandating low-VOC products are also contributing to market growth. Europe follows closely, with a significant share of the market driven by a high demand for sustainable and high-performance coatings across various applications, including industrial and automotive sectors. The CAGR for Europe is projected at around 5.9%, driven by increasing investments in green building projects and stringent environmental policies.
In the Asia Pacific region, the silicone alkyd top coat market is expected to experience rapid growth, projected to achieve a CAGR of 7.5% during the forecast period. Factors such as rapid urbanization, increasing infrastructure spending, and expanding manufacturing activities are fueling the demand for silicone alkyd coatings. Countries like China and India are at the forefront of this growth, with their booming construction markets and increasing focus on sustainable solutions.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are also witnessing growth, although at a slower pace, with emerging economies driving demand for high-quality coatings in construction and industrial applications. Overall, the regional dynamics indicate a strong and diverse market landscape, with each region presenting unique growth opportunities.
